From eb9fb1f5ca9fcf8eab476908c34f05d4955ea27d Mon Sep 17 00:00:00 2001
From: Daniel Gustafsson <dgustafsson@postgresql.org>
Date: Wed, 25 Jun 2025 14:24:20 +0200
Subject: [PATCH v6 2/6] pg_dump compression API: write_func
Make write_func throw an error on all error conditions. All callers of
write_func were already checking for success and calling pg_fatal on all
errors, so we might as well make the API support that case directly with
simpler errorhandling as a result. Returns the number of bytes written
in case of success, which will match the size of the buffer passed in.
